Figure 1 Our work researches the effects of incarceration in Norway, a setup with two vital benefits




We can better link this information to various other member of the family, including youngsters and brother or sisters. Furthermore, we have information on co-offending that enables us to map out criminal networks for observed criminal offenses. Second, we can take advantage of the arbitrary task of criminal instances to courts that vary in their propensities to send defendants to jail.


Some judges send accuseds to jail at a high rate, while others are more forgiving. We measure a judge's stringency as the ordinary imprisonment price for all other situations a judge deals with, after controlling for court and year set effects, which is the degree of random project. This quasi-random job of judge stringency can be used as an instrument for imprisonment, as it highly forecasts the judge's decision in the present case, however is uncorrelated with other instance features both by style and empirically.

Features of detainees, including demographics and criminal activity classifications, are generally similar in Norway and various other nations, including the United States, with the exceptions that the United States homicide price is a lot higher, and race plays a larger function there too. What stands out as different, specifically compared to the United States, is the jail system.


Figure 2In Norway, the typical time invested in jail is a little over 6 months, which is comparable to most various other Western European nations. This contrasts with ordinary United States jail time of almost 3 years, which remains in huge part the factor the USA is an outlier in its incarceration rate compared to the remainder of the world [Number 1]

Our study on the results of incarceration on the offender, making use of the random project of judges as an instrument, yields 3 essential findings. First, jail time discourages even more criminal actions. We locate that incarceration reduces the possibility that a person will certainly reoffend within 5 years by 27 portion factors and decreases the corresponding number of criminal costs per person by 10 costs.

We discover substantial declines in reoffending chances and collective billed criminal activities also after offenders are released from jail. Our 2nd result is that prejudice because of option on unobservable individual features, if ignored, brings about the erroneous conclusion that time invested in jail is criminogenic. If we merely contrast criminal defendants imprisoned versus those not imprisoned, we locate favorable associations between incarceration and succeeding criminal offense.


This stands in contrast to our analysis based on the arbitrary task of courts, which locates an opposite-signed result. Third, the reduction in crime is driven by people who were not working before incarceration. Among these people, imprisonment increases involvement in programs guided at improving employability and reducing recidivism, and this ultimately raises employment and profits while preventing criminal behavior.

Imprisonment triggers a 34 portion factor boost in involvement in job training programs for the previously nonemployed, and within 5 years their work price boosts by 40 portion points. At the same time, the likelihood of reoffending within 5 years is cut by 46 percentage points, and there is a decline check this of 22 in the typical number of criminal charges.

How kids are influenced will likely depend on whether jail time was corrective for their moms and dad. Using our court stringency instrument, we find that incarceration has no impact on a daddy's probability of devoting future crime. But it does reduce their work by 20 portion points. Fathers are eight years older usually and significantly more probable to be utilized prior to incarceration than accuseds generally, which assists discuss the heterogeneous effects for daddies versus various other defendants.


Common least squares approximates disclose that kids of incarcerated fathers are 1 portion point most likely to be billed with a criminal offense, about a mean of 13 percent, and show no impact on institution qualities. Using our judge stringency tool, we find no statistical proof that a father's imprisonment affects a youngster's very own criminal activity or school qualities, however we are not able to rule out modest-sized impacts.

We specify criminal teams based on network links to previous criminal situations. Our analysis yields three main findings. Initially, when a criminal network participant is put behind bars, their peers' likelihood of being charged with a future criminal offense lowers by 51 percent points over the next four years. Similarly, having an older bro jailed decreases the probability his younger brother will certainly be billed with a criminal offense by 32 percentage points over the following four years.
